Motor processes in simple, go/no-go, and choice reaction time tasks: A psychophysiological analysis.

Psychophysiological measures were used to compare the response preparation and response execution processes of modified versions of F. C. Donders's (1868/1969) classic simple, go/no-go, and choice reaction time tasks. On all measures, differences between tasks were minimal prior to test stimulus onset, supporting the idea of equivalent motor preparation for the 3 tasks. In addition, the psychophysiological measures indicated that the time from the onset of motor processing to the keypress response was also approximately constant across tasks. These results support the assumption that the mean duration of motor processes can be invariant across simple, go/no-go, and choice tasks, at least for the present modified versions of these tasks. The findings emphasize the utility of psychophysiological measures for both examining preparatory processes preceding stimulus onset and for localizing effects on reaction time.
